CableClix (USA), Inc. (OTCPK:CCLX) is pioneering online TV evolution by designing the first ‘lean-back experience’ for online viewing. Lean-back – continuous delivery of TV broadcast, common for cable TV but not yet for online viewing – gives audiences more viewing time, delivered as uninterrupted play of highly personalized content.

Lean-back play solves the problem of audiences losing hours of viewing time just browsing through menus deciding what to watch next. CableClix’s research – with audiences as well as executives from major online platforms, studios and multi-channel networks – revealed a consistent issue across the video content landscape: usability.
